Description

Exodigo is the leading underground mapping solution for non-intrusive discovery. Our platforms combine multi-sensor fusion, 3D imaging, and AI technologies to create complete, accurate underground maps that enable confident decision-making for customers across the built world. We transform the project lifecycle for our customers, who include key community stakeholders in the utilities, transportation and government sectors. 

We are experiencing sky-rocketing growth and closed a historically large $105M Series A round in February of 2024.



Job description

As we scale, we recognize the critical role of Learning & Development (L&D) in enabling our field operations teams to succeed. We are looking for a Learning & Development Specialist to drive training programs, enhance workforce capabilities, and foster continuous learning across our US site.

Position Overview:

We seek a dynamic and results-driven L&D Specialist to design, implement, and optimize training programs tailored to field operations. This role requires strong instructional design expertise, a deep understanding of adult learning principles, and the ability to create and deliver training in both English and Spanish. The ideal candidate will collaborate with field teams, subject matter experts, and leadership to ensure operational excellence and compliance through effective learning solutions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Training Development & Delivery: Design, develop, and implement engaging learning programs tailored to field operations teams. Facilitate in-person and virtual training sessions in both English and Spanish.
  • Needs Assessment: Conduct training needs analyses to identify skill gaps and implement learning interventions that enhance workforce performance.
  • Instructional Design: Create e-learning modules, instructor-led training, job aids, and blended learning solutions.
  • Onboarding & Compliance: Lead the onboarding process for new hires and ensure compliance with safety, operational, and regulatory training requirements.
  • Evaluation & Metrics: Assess training effectiveness through feedback, assessments, and performance metrics to continuously improve L&D initiatives.
  • Stakeholder Collaboration: Partner with operations leaders, HR, and subject matter experts to align learning strategies with business goals.
  • Technology Integration: Utilize learning management systems (LMS) and other digital tools to deliver and track training initiatives.



Requirements

  • Bilingual proficiency in English and Spanish (written and spoken) required.
  • 3+ years of experience in Learning & Development, instructional design, and training facilitation.
  • Background in the field operations or technical environment preferable.
  • Experience developing blended learning solutions (e-learning, instructor-led, and hands-on training).
  • Familiarity with LMS platforms and digital learning tools.
  • Excellent facilitation, coaching, and communication skills.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a fast-paced, evolving environment.
  • Willingness to travel frequently.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
